GLENFARCLAS - 15 years - 46%
The Glenfarclas distillery is located in Ballindalloch, in the heart of the prestigious Speyside region in Scotland, renowned for its exceptional whiskies. Founded well before 1791, it officially obtained its license in 1836 under the direction of Robert Hay. On June 8, 1865, the distillery was acquired by John Grant and remains to this day a true family business, owned and managed by his descendants with passion and traditional know-how. In 2007, Glenfarclas launched the famous The Family Casks collection, composed of 43 Single Cask bottlings, with an unparalleled rarity: one cask per year from 1952 to 1994. This prestigious collection now extends up to 2001, despite the depletion of stocks from the 1952 and 1953 casks, bearing witness to the rich and continuous history of the house.
Glenfarclas 15 years is an exceptional whisky, fully matured in carefully selected sherry casks. It is bottled at 46%, an alcohol level chosen in homage to the preference of George Grant's grandfather, thus ensuring optimal aromatic richness. This whisky offers a broad and balanced tasting experience, delicately combining the smooth sweetness of sherry with subtle malty notes, for a refined and harmonious palate.
